In Condé Nast Traveler’s recent round-up of ‘what the editors are loving this February’, one Australian hideaway stood out: Orpheus Island Lodge. Editor Preshita Saha described her solo escape as a moment of pure recalibration, writing:

“There’s something about being on a private island where the only footprints in the sand are your own. Waking up to the Great Barrier Reef on your doorstep, snorkelling among turtles and vibrant corals, and watching the sun set over the endless blue – it’s a kind of serenity that feels sculpted by imagination.”

Set within the pristine waters of the Great Barrier Reef, Orpheus Island Lodge combines unspoiled natural beauty with contemporary comfort, offering guests an intimate connection with Australia’s extraordinary marine environment.
